Consoles = Standard Edition (80's) or Classic Edition (80's & 90's)

1/ PC - Standard Edition DVD (80's) - Upgrade to Classic Edition via Steam DLC (add 90's)

2/ PC - Standard Edition Steam version (80's) - Upgrade to Classic via Steam DLC (add 90's)

3/ PC - Classic Edition (80's & 90's) Digital Steam Package ...... This does not exist.

Number 3 is a possibility (not announced) and may not happen, but it would seem logical to be able to buy the whole Classic Version as a package on Steam, in one deal
